‘Eye for an eye’: Eating Syrian soldier’s heart was legitimate act of vengeance, says rebel in gruesome video
A Syrian rebel militia leader who filmed cutting the heart and organs out of a regime soldier’s body and putting it in his mouth has defended his actions as legitimate vengeance.
The video purported to show him cutting the lungs out of a soldier’s corpse before apparently eating a small piece of the organ. “I swear to God we will eat your hearts,
speaking to Time magazine, he said he had no regrets about taking revenge – “an eye for an eye, a tooth for a tooth” – after finding images of regime abuses on the dead soldier’s mobile phone.
“We opened his cell phone and I found a clip of a woman and her two daughters fully naked, and he was humiliating them,” he said. “Hopefully, we will slaughter all of them
He said that he possessed another video of himself “sawing” a member of the pro-regime Shabiha militia with a “saw we use to cut trees.” Hamad added: “I sawed him in small pieces and large ones.”
In Damascus, Ali Haider, the minister for reconciliation, said this was only one of many atrocities carried out by the regime’s enemies.
“If the international media has just discovered this now, then they are coming to it very late. These type of atrocities have been happening in Syria since the beginning of the crisis. The international community just didn’t want to admit it,” he said.
“We have documented hundreds of acts that are equally as horrific as the one documented in this video. We have seen one of our pilots’ heads cut off and cooked on a grill. We have seen rebels toasting their success by drinking the blood of their victims.”
“Did you see what these animals do?” asked one woman who declined to give her name. “They are devils. How can any human being do this? How can the West support these extremists?”
Human Rights Watch said Hamad should be brought to justice. “The desecration and mutilation of a killed person is definitely a war crime,” said Peter Bouckaert, the emergencies director. “This one is particularly disturbing because of the sectarian nature of the language used.”
He described the rebel as a “very significant commander” adding: “The danger is that extremists on both sides will feel the need to respond in kind.”

In April 2012, the Farouq Brigade was accused of collecting Jizyah, or taxes imposed on non-Muslims living under Muslim rule, in Christian areas of Homs province.
There were also reports that the group had expelled 90% of the Christian population of Homs City.
n August 2012, Lieutenant Abdul Razzaq Tlass, one of the Farouq Brigades top leaders, was implicated in a sex scandal when the video was posted to YouTube
In May 2013, a video was posted on the internet showing rebel commander Abu Sakkar cutting organs from the dead body of a Syrian soldier and putting one of them in his mouth, "as if he is taking a bite out of it". He called rebels to follow his example and terrorize the Alawite sect
